  • AngloGold Ashanti (Ghana) Limited is currently on a journey to redevelop the Obuasi Gold Mine into a modern, efficient and long-term profitable operation. The underground mining operation will be fully mechanized, designed to produce up to an average maximum of 5,000 t/day of ore mined.

    Business Improvement Data Technician(20753)

    Role Purpose

    • To provide support for data collection, input, and analysis to support implementation of critical improvement projects / ideas that deliver and promote a culture of sustainable continuous improvements (CI) across site.

    Role Accountabilities

    • Support departmental continuous improvement sustainability tasks and processes towards achieving key Business Improvement metric targets  
    • Conduct relevant data collection, data inputting into the relevant database and data analysis to complement site Analyze & Improve efforts.
    • Assist in business requirements reports and presentations as and when required by the department.
    • Assist departmental IFs in loading and completing Operational Excellence idea requirements in PIPware.
    • Conduct periodic analysis using PIPware data to enhance integrity and fast track idea velocity.
    • Use the existing (and other) analytical tools to develop and implement efficient business processes at the operational level in mining, processing, engineering, and supporting services.

    Person’s Specification

    Qualification

    • Minimum of Higher National Diploma in Statistics or Accounting with knowledge in statistics

    Experience

    • At least one year post qualification experience in data capturing and statistical analysis.

    Technical Competencies

    • Must possess valid Ghanain Driving Licence to operate Light Vehicle
    •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ite.
    • Knowledge of PIPware software and Control Chart (Power BI)
    • Building Effective Working Relationships - The ability to build and maintain effective collateral and cross-functional working relationship, coach and develop a team to deliver at their highest capability
    • Building Trust & Accountability – Displaying high levels of integrity and honesty
    • Must be strong and energetic and ability to work for long hours with quality of work as a priority
    • Must have excellent interpersonal and human relations and ability to interact with people of diverse culture and values
